Assertion (A): Effective vertical stress at some depth below a river bed is unaffected by the water depth in the river.
Reason (R): Equal amounts of increase in total stress and pore pressure will not change the effective stress.

Solution

The correct option is A both A and R are true and R is the correct explanation of A
(a)
Effective stress = Total stress - pore pressure. Effective stress remains unaffected by water depth in river.
